.page { position: relative; display: flex; flex-direction: column; overflow: auto; } main { flex: 1; margin: 0; padding: 0; } article { padding: 0 !important; margin: 0 !important; } .receiver-footer { display: flex; justify-content: space-between; align-items: center; padding: 1rem 2rem; gap: 1rem; } .receiver-footer__content { display: flex; align-items: center; gap: 0.5rem; }